public _00045_Mensaje(long mesaId) : this(new CuentaCorrienteServicio(), new ComprobanteMesaServicio(), new ClienteServicio()) { Realizo = false; _mesaId = mesaId; _total = _comprobanteMesaServicio.ObtenerComprobanteMesa(_mesaId).Total; Efectivo = false; CtaCte = false; _tipoComprobante = TipoComprobante.X; }
private void ActualizarGrilla(long mesaId) { var comprobante = _mesaServicio.ObtenerComprobanteMesa(mesaId); dgvGrilla.DataSource = comprobante.Items.Where(x => x.Cantidad > 0).ToList(); //TODO //dgvGrilla.Columns.Add( // _columnButton = new DataGridViewButtonColumn() // { // Name = "Borrar", // HeaderText = "Borrar", // AutoSizeMode = DataGridViewAutoSizeColumnMode.ColumnHeader, // FlatStyle = FlatStyle.Flat, // DefaultCellStyle = new DataGridViewCellStyle // { // Padding = new Padding(10, 0, 10, 0), // SelectionBackColor = Color.Orange, // Alignment = DataGridViewContentAlignment.MiddleCenter, // WrapMode=DataGridViewTriState.True // } // , FillWeight = 30, // ValueType = typeof(Button), // Text = "X", // } // ); txtNombre.Text = comprobante.DniCliente == "99999999"? comprobante.ApyNomCl :comprobante.ContactoCliente; txtMozo.Text = comprobante.ApyNomMozo; txtLegajo.Text = comprobante.Legajo.ToString(); nudSubTotal.Value = comprobante.SubTotal; nudDescuento.Value = comprobante.Descuento; nudComensales.Value = comprobante.Comensal; nudTotal.Value = comprobante.Total; Total = comprobante.Total; txtCodigos.Text = string.Empty; txtDescripcion.Text = string.Empty; txtPrecio.Text = string.Empty; nudCantidad.Value = 1m; }
protected void ActualizarNumero(long mesaId) { PrecioConsumido = _comprobanteServicio.ObtenerComprobanteMesa(mesaId).Total; }
public FormaPagoMesa(long mesaId) : this(new CuentaCorrienteServicio(), new FormaPagoServicio(), new DetalleCajaServicio(), new ComprobanteMesaServicio(), new OperacionServicio()) { _comprobante = _comprobanteMesaServicio.ObtenerComprobanteMesa(mesaId); SetTotal(_comprobante.Total); }